WebA Community Health Worker Training Resource A Community Health Worker Training Resource for Preventing Heart Disease and Stroke (2015) is an evidence-based, plain-language training resource and reference for CHWs, as well as a curriculum that health educators, nurses, and other instructors can use to train CHWs. WebJun 1, 2024 · CHWs are trained public health workers who serve as a bridge between communities, health care systems, and state health departments. Online courses, … WebSep 8, 2024 · Some states require community health workers (CHWs) to meet training or certification standards. Credentialing and certification programs are often implemented by a department of health or department of public health. Other state programs are implemented by a department of human services, board of nursing, or third-party entity.
